    I recently updated AVAST (approx 10-15 days ago -- can't remember for sure) and since then I have noticed that my PC has been a bit sluggish. I also recently noticed, after the update that the VRDB icon in always in my tray -- I don't remember it ever being there except when I first installed avast a few years back. I don't know how it went away - it could have always been there but hidden - maybe I needed to click on "Show Hidden Icons" to see it.

    I checked my Task Manager and noticed that the CPU usage spikes between 0 and 80/90% on a regular basis.

    I have disabled VRDB - seems that other posts have suggested doing that. I am not sure that had any impact on the CPU usage.

    Anything sound wrong here to you guys?
